get https://{subdominio}.kommo.com/api/v4/users
Este método permite obtener los datos del usuario en la cuenta mediante el ID del usuario.
Limitaciones
El método está disponible solo para usuarios administradores.
Encabezado de tipo de datos cuando la solicitud es exitosa
Content-Type: application/hal+json.
Encabezado de tipo de datos en caso de un error
Content-Type: application/problem+json.
Parámetros para los parámetros GET "with"
Parámetro | Descripción |
---|---|
role | Añade el rol del usuario en la respuesta. |
group | Añade el grupo del usuario en la respuesta. |
uuid | Añade el UUID del usuario en la respuesta, puede ser nulo, actualmente el UUID no se utiliza para integraciones de terceros. |
amojo_id | Añade el ID del usuario en el servicio de chat a la respuesta, puede ser nulo. |
user_rank | Añade el rango del usuario a la respuesta. Opciones posibles: principiante/candidato/maestro. |
Parámetros de respuesta
El método retorna un objeto usuario. Las propiedades del objeto se enumeran a continuación.
Los objetos de derechos tienen una estructura común. Dependiendo del tipo de entidad, estos objetos contienen acciones disponibles como claves y los derechos para la acción como valor. Por ejemplo, rights[leads][view]=A.
Parámetro | Tipo de dato | Descripción |
---|---|---|
id | int | ID del usuario. |
name | string | Nombre completo del usuario. |
string | Correo del usuario. | |
lang | string | Idioma del usuario. Uno de los siguientes: en, es, pt. |
rights | object | Permisos del usuario. |
rights[leads] | object | Objeto de permisos de acceso a los leads. |
rights[contacts] | object | Objeto de permisos de acceso a los contactos. |
rights[companies] | object | Objeto de permisos de acceso a compañías. |
rights[tasks] | object | Objeto de permisos de acceso a tareas. |
rights[mail_access] | bool | Define si la funcionalidad de Correo está permitida para el usuario. |
rights[catalog_access] | bool | Define si la funcionalidad de Listas está permitida para el usuario. |
rights[is_admin] | bool | Define si el usuario tiene derechos de administrador. |
rights[is_free] | bool | Define si es un usuario gratuito. |
rights[is_active] | bool | Define si el usuario se encuentra activo. |
rights[group_id] | int|null | ID del grupo del usuario. |
rights[role_id] | int|null | ID del rol del usuario. |
rights[status_rights] | array | Un arreglo de objetos que define los permisos de las etapas. |
rights[status_rights][0] | object | Un objeto de derechos de etapa. |
rights[status_rights][0][entity_type] | string | Tipo de entidad. Actualmente, solo se admite la entidad de lead. |
rights[status_rights][0][pipeline_id] | int | ID del pipeline en el que se encuentra la etapa. |
rights[status_rights][0][status_id] | int | ID de la etapa. |
rights[status_rights][0][rights] | object | Objeto de derechos. |